学编程最好的语音软件是什么
-
学编程最好的语音软件是Visual Studio Code(简称VS Code)。VS Code是一个轻量级的代码编辑器,由微软开发并持续维护。它具有强大的功能和丰富的扩展生态系统,因此被广泛认为是学习和实践编程的最佳选择。
首先,VS Code具有出色的代码编辑功能。它支持多种编程语言,如JavaScript、Python、C++等,并提供智能代码补全、语法高亮、代码片段等功能,使编码变得更加高效和准确。
其次,VS Code拥有丰富的扩展生态系统。用户可以根据自己的需求选择安装各种插件,以增强编辑器的功能。例如,可以安装代码格式化插件、版本控制插件、调试器插件等,以提高编程效率和质量。
此外,VS Code还支持集成终端,方便用户在编辑器内执行命令和运行程序。这使得编程学习过程更加流畅,无需频繁切换窗口。
此外,VS Code还支持版本控制系统,如Git,可以轻松管理代码的版本和变更历史。这对于团队协作和项目管理非常重要。
总之,学编程最好的语音软件是Visual Studio Code。它的强大功能和丰富的扩展生态系统使其成为学习和实践编程的理想选择。无论是初学者还是经验丰富的开发人员,都可以从中获得巨大的帮助和便利。
1年前 -
在学习编程过程中,有很多语音软件可以帮助提高效率和学习效果。以下是一些被广泛认为是最好的编程语音软件:
-
Dragon NaturallySpeaking:这是一个功能强大且广泛使用的语音识别软件,被认为是最好的语音软件之一。它具有准确的语音识别能力,可以快速将语音转换为文本。对于编程,Dragon NaturallySpeaking可以帮助程序员通过语音输入代码,提高编码速度和准确性。
-
VoiceCode:这是一个专为编程而设计的语音识别软件。它具有针对编程语言的特定识别模型,可以识别常见的编程关键字和语法结构。VoiceCode还提供了一些特殊的命令和操作,使编程更加便捷和高效。
-
Cortana:这是Windows操作系统中自带的语音助手,可以执行各种任务,包括编程。Cortana可以帮助你在编程中进行语法检查、代码搜索和文档查询等操作。它还可以与其他编程工具和IDE集成,提供更强大的功能。
-
Siri:这是苹果操作系统中的语音助手,也可以用于编程。Siri可以执行各种编程任务,包括代码输入、代码搜索和API文档查询。它还可以与其他编程工具和IDE集成,提供更多的功能。
-
Google语音输入:这是一个免费的语音输入软件,可用于编程。Google语音输入具有准确的语音识别能力,可以将语音转换为文本。它还可以与其他编程工具和IDE集成,提供更多的功能和便利。
虽然以上语音软件可以帮助提高编程效率,但仍然需要注意以下几点:
-
准确性:尽管语音识别技术已经得到了很大的改进,但仍然可能存在误识别的情况。在使用语音软件进行编程时,需要仔细检查和校对识别结果,以确保代码的准确性。
-
学习曲线:使用语音软件进行编程可能需要一定的学习曲线,特别是对于那些不熟悉语音输入的人来说。需要适应语音输入的方式和命令,以提高效率和准确性。
-
环境噪音:语音识别软件对环境噪音比较敏感,因此在使用语音软件进行编程时,最好选择一个相对安静的环境,以减少干扰和误识别。
总之,选择最适合自己的编程语音软件需要考虑个人的需求和偏好。以上提到的语音软件都有各自的优势和特点,可以根据个人的需求和预算选择适合的软件。
1年前 -
-
学编程最好的语音软件是SpeechRecognition。
SpeechRecognition是一个Python库,它提供了一个简单的API,用于将语音转换为文本。它可以与多种语音识别引擎配合使用,包括Google Speech Recognition、CMU Sphinx、Microsoft Bing Voice Recognition等。
下面是使用SpeechRecognition进行语音识别的操作流程:
- 安装SpeechRecognition库:使用pip命令在命令行中安装SpeechRecognition库。可以使用以下命令进行安装:
pip install SpeechRecognition- 导入SpeechRecognition库:在Python脚本中导入SpeechRecognition库,以便使用其中的功能。
import speech_recognition as sr- 创建Recognizer对象:通过创建Recognizer对象来实现语音识别。可以使用以下代码创建一个Recognizer对象:
r = sr.Recognizer()- 选择语音识别引擎:使用Recognizer对象的
recognize_sphinx()方法选择语音识别引擎。例如,选择Google Speech Recognition作为语音识别引擎:
r.recognize_google()- 识别语音:使用Recognizer对象的
recognize_*()方法进行语音识别。例如,使用麦克风进行实时语音识别:
with sr.Microphone() as source: audio = r.listen(source)- 将语音转换为文本:使用Recognizer对象的
recognize_*()方法将语音转换为文本。例如,将语音转换为文本:
text = r.recognize_google(audio)以上是使用SpeechRecognition进行语音识别的基本操作流程。通过使用SpeechRecognition,可以将语音转换为文本,从而实现语音编程等功能。
1年前